Output f6478e8336063a3b31990f10a86c832afa8829b53200740e0c9c72d3a842e5da:44

value
4370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fcb7304ff8443c8425743cb5110323d2989c367 OP_EQUAL
address
3EoLGt1if9tnWz17XxQBAFsC44HcE2C3Vd
transaction
f6478e8336063a3b31990f10a86c832afa8829b53200740e0c9c72d3a842e5da
confirmations
288647
spent
true